This 2002 Wellcraft 290 Coastal is a 30-foot express sportfish powered by twin Suzuki 300HP 4-stroke outboards installed in 2023, with 280 hours on both engines. The fiberglass hull carries 225 gallons of fuel and 42 gallons of fresh water, supported by a service history including three full services since new, most recently in September 2025. Bottom paint was refreshed in 2022 and remains in excellent condition.
The 2023 repower and upgrades brought new helm and hydraulic steering, a new isinglass enclosure added in May 2025, and throughout-the-boat upholstery replacement. A windlass with new rope, chain, and anchor complement the deck gear, while a portable generator and air-conditioning system provide comfort. Electronics include a Garmin GPSMap 1040XS with fish finder, VHF radio, battery charger, and a True Power 2000MS marine inverter.
Below deck, the boat sleeps four across a forward cabin with twin pilot berths, a dinette that converts to a double, and a mid-cabin with two berths. The galley is fitted with a refrigerator, microwave, hot water heater, and liquid gas stove. A Vacuflush head with wet shower and hot and cold stern showers serve the accommodation. The cabin is air-conditioned via the portable generator system.
The cockpit is designed for serious fishing with dual large fish boxes, a livewell with viewing window on the starboard side, numerous rod holders, and a spacious working area. A bait prep station sits within easy reach, and the helm accommodates two with an adjustable operator seat and beverage holders. Navigation is straightforward from the well-appointed helm with easy-to-read gauges.
